利用深度学习算法提高靠垫瑕疵检测的准确性和效率
近年来,借助深度学习算法的强大能力,图像识别已被广泛应用于各种工业检测任务中,包括靠垫瑕疵检测。要提高检测的准确性和效率,需要从多个方面优化深度学习算法及其应用。以下是一些关键步骤和建议:
数据收集与预处理
为了训练一个有效的深度学习模型,首先需要大量高质量的训练数据。采集数据时,要确保数据集覆盖各种可能的瑕疵类型、大小、颜色及不同的拍摄角度。数据预处理也是至关重要的,主要包括以下几点:
- 图像增强:通过旋转、缩放、裁剪、添加噪声等技术,增强数据集的多样性。
- 标准化:对图片进行标准化处理,如调整图片的尺寸和色值范围。
- 标签标注:准确标注瑕疵的位置和类型,以便训练模型验证结果。
模型选择与优化
选择一个合适的深度学习模型是成功的关键,当前常用的模型包括卷积神经网络(CNN)、区域卷积神经网络(R-CNN)、YOLO(You Only Look Once)及SSD(Single Shot MultiBox Detector)等。
具体建议如下:
- 选择合适的模型架构:根据瑕疵的特征和检测要求选择合适的网络架构,如YOLO适合实时检测任务。
- 模型微调:使用迁移学习技术,基于预训练模型进行微调,以利用现有模型的特征提取能力。
- 超参数调整:通过交叉验证,优化模型的学习率、批量大小等超参数,以提高模型性能。
模型训练与评估
模型的训练和评估是一个迭代的过程,应不断进行以下环节:
- 训练过程监控:使用验证集监控训练过程中的过拟合或欠拟合,并进行相应调整。
- 评估指标:采用准确率、召回率、F1得分等多种指标进行评估,以全面衡量模型性能。
- 模型集成:可考虑集成多个模型,以提高整体的检测准确性和鲁棒性。
模型部署与维护
模型部署阶段需要将训练好的模型集成到生产环境中。关键点包括:
- 硬件加速:利用GPU加速模型推理,以提高检测效率。
- 实时监控与迭代:通过实时反馈机制,持续收集新数据以定期更新模型,保证其检测性能。
通过以上步骤和建议,可以有效利用深度学习算法提高靠垫瑕疵检测的准确性和效率。不断优化数据、模型和系统流程,将帮助企业在质量控制任务中实现更高的自动化水平和检测能力。